About Brian Tee

“Brian Tee is a lead in the up and coming summer blockbuster “The Wolverine” with past lead roles in the TV show Crash, and the movie “The Fast and the Furious: Tokyo Drift” and more. Brian leads the cast of Mortal Kombat Legacy in its second season, as one of the biggest new additions to the live-action adaptation. Brian portrays the famous Shaolin fighting monk and traditional series Iconic Hero: Liu Kang

About Mortal Kombat Legacy

The first season of “Mortal Kombat Legacy” was one of the hottest online series to hit the web in 2011. Mortal Kombat Legacy has more than 60 million views to-date on Machinima.com. In the second season the MKL saga continues with Brian Tee portraying Liu Kang — the traditional hero of the Mortal Kombat tournament, but with a darker and infinitely complex side to Liu Kang, the series promises to be even bigger and better then the last.
